Yurei

Yurei is a ransomware group first observed in September 2025 whose payload is a minimally modified fork of the open-source Prince-Ransomware, using ChaCha20 encryption and propagating across SMB shares, primarily targeting food manufacturing, transportation, and IT sectors in Sri Lanka and Nigeria.
